A big chunk of the world became familiar with Chappo in 2010 when the Brooklyn band licensed their song "Come" (featured in their debut EP) to Apple for an iPod Touch commercial . In the following years the group released another EP and a full length in 2012, while Chappo's singer Zac, together with NYC based Jupiter One singer K, also started working on material for psychedelic side project Fancy Colors . Brooklyn electro-rock band Chappo has come a long way since I saw them play Dynasty Electric's loft party a number of years ago. The band released their debut LP, Moonwater , earlier this year via Majordomo Records (an imprint of Shout! Factory), which Consequence of Sound described as " explor[ing] the simple splendor of youth through their wide-eyed storytelling and space-y instrumentation, sounding like MGMT coming down off a great acid trip. Let’s all take a step down off our corporation-hating high horses and admit something: Those damn Apple commercials have some pretty dope music (well, maybe with one exception ). One of the newest recipients of the coveted “Apple bump” is Brooklyn’s CHAPPO , whose song “Come Home” appeared in a recent iPod Touch commercial. On the band’s debut full-length, Moonwater , CHAPPO explore the simple splendor of youth through their wide-eyed storytelling and space-y instrumentation, sounding like MGMT coming down off a great acid trip.
